Royal Flying Doctor Service Museum - Further Information

The Royal Flying Doctor Service is the first, largest and most comprehensive aeromedical organisation in the world.

The RFDS of Australia is a not-for-profit charitable Service providing air ambulance emergency and primary health care services together with communication and education assistance to people who live, work and travel in regional and remote Australia.

Founded in 1928 by the Rev. John Flynn of the Australian Inland Mission, it married the fledgling technologies of flight and radio communication to provide a vital lifeline to those in remote and pioneering under-resourced communities. The Service retains the very highest regard from the people of Australia and is heavily reliant on community support for funding. The RFDS operates in four sectors of Australia - Central, Western, Queensland and South Eastern Section.
